Oppo Reno 14 Series Hits Indian Market with Stellar Features

Launch Details and Availability

Oppo unveiled the Reno 14 and Reno 14 Pro 5G in India on July 3, 2025, with sales starting July 8 via Amazon, Flipkart, Oppo’s e-store, and offline retailers. The launch, celebrated at events like Reliance Digital’s showcase in Chennai and Bhajanlal’s event in Kolkata with Tollywood star Koushani Mukherjee, highlights Oppo’s focus on premium retail experiences. Pre-orders began last week, with attractive offers boosting initial sales.

Pricing and Variants

The Reno 14 5G starts at Rs 37,999 for the 8GB RAM + 256GB storage variant, with 12GB + 256GB at Rs 39,999 and 12GB + 512GB at Rs 42,999. It’s available in Forest Green and Pearl White. The Reno 14 Pro 5G is priced at Rs 49,999 (12GB + 256GB) and Rs 54,999 (12GB + 512GB), offered in Pearl White and Titanium Grey. Camera Capabilities

Both models boast a 50MP triple rear camera setup. The Reno 14 features a 50MP main IMX882 sensor with OIS, an 8MP ultra-wide OV08D lens, and a 50MP 3.5x telephoto JN5 sensor. The Pro variant upgrades to a 50MP OV50E main sensor and a 50MP periscope telephoto with 3.5x optical zoom, supporting 4K HDR video at 60fps. Both include a 50MP selfie camera with autofocus and AI features like AI Editor 2.0, AI Perfect Shot, and AI LivePhoto 2.0 for enhanced photography.

Performance and Chipsets

The Reno 14 is powered by the MediaTek Dimensity 8350 chipset, while the Pro model uses the advanced Dimensity 8450 with a Dual Cooling System for better heat dissipation. Both support up to 16GB RAM and 1TB storage, ensuring smooth multitasking and gaming. They run on ColorOS 15, based on Android 15, with Google Gemini AI integration for task automation.

Display and Design

The Reno 14 sports a 6.59-inch 1.5K OLED display with a 120Hz refresh rate, protected by Corning Gorilla Glass 7i or Oppo’s Crystal Shield Glass. The Pro model features a larger 6.83-inch OLED LTPS panel with HDR10+ support. Both offer 1200 nits peak brightness, 3840Hz PWM dimming for eye comfort, and a 93.4% screen-to-body ratio. The design includes flat-edged frames, a Velvet Glass back, and a Luminous Loop camera ring.

Battery and Charging

The Reno 14 houses a 6,000mAh battery with 80W wired charging, while the Pro model has a 6,200mAh battery with 80W wired and 50W wireless charging, plus reverse charging. Both are IP66, IP68, and IP69 rated for dust, water, and high-pressure spray resistance, ensuring durability.

Special Features

The series introduces a temperature-sensitive color-changing rear panel in the Sun and Moonlight variant, shifting from Sunlight Orange at -15°C to Moonlight Silver above 60°C. Other features include in-display fingerprint sensors, stereo speakers, and a Magic Cube Key on the Pro model, similar to an action button for customizable functions.
